Uploading Files

Once you've created a project, you need to give it some files. There are a few ways to do this.

Upload a ZIP

The fastest way. Zip up your site folder and upload it. EzyHost automatically extracts everything and puts the files in the right place. If your ZIP has a single top-level folder, we'll flatten it so your index.html ends up at the root.

Drag & drop individual files

You can also drag files straight into the upload area. Handy when you just need to update an image or add a new page.

Upload during project creation

You don't have to create a project first and then upload. The "New Project" form has a file upload section built in — fill in the details, attach your files, and everything gets created and deployed in one go.

What happens after upload

Files are scanned for safety (magic byte validation + antivirus)
Everything is uploaded to cloud storage
Your site goes live immediately at its subdomain
SEO analysis runs automatically on your index.html (paid plans)

Managing files

Inside your project, you'll see a list of all uploaded files. From there you can:

RenameChange the file path or name
DeleteRemove individual files or bulk-select and delete
Re-uploadUpload new files — if a file with the same name exists, it gets replaced

File size limits

Individual files can be up to 100 MB. Total storage depends on your plan — 10 MB on free, up to 2 TB on Pro Max. Files inside ZIPs are limited to 50 MB each.

Tip: Make sure your main page is called index.html — that's what loads when someone visits your site URL.